Sunday, June 29, 2008
Our Dossier is on the way!
Okay after a few very crazy moments we have been able to get our dossier together. Our friends Jack & Stephanie Higgins had to take some papers down to have apostilled for their adoption of Anya and so they graciously took all of our documents (38 to be exact). Then on Friday we made a trip to Acworth to deliver our documents to a couple who are heading to Latvia this week. They will hand deliver these documents to our lawyer for us; who will have them translated and then she will file them with the courts. Hopefully we will receive an invitation to come to Latvia soon. Presently it seems to be taking about 3 months to get a court date.

Please continue uplifting us in your prayers. We are waiting for the final Home Study Report (all the information is in). After we receive this we will send it in to the INS to get our Homeland Security clearance and at the same time we will begin working on our dossier to send to Latvia. Shortly (hopefully) after we send in our dossier to Latvia we will get an invitation to come there. On this first visit (1 of 3) we will have to stay approximately 14 days. Arturs will stay with us. There will be a social worker who will be checking in on us to see if we are compatible...if so she will make a recommendation to the officials and we will be able to file papers to adopt Arturs. We should be able to get temporary custody of him at that time and will be able to bring Arturs home to America with us. He will have to return for the other 2 visits, but more on that later.
